
Ingredients :
Green coriander leaves – one big bunch
Oil
Red chillies 5-6
Tamarind - Small lemon sized ball
Kadalai paruppu – 2 tsp
Vellai Ullatham Paruppu (white urad dal) – 2 tsp
Salt
Sugar – ½ tsp
Perungayam - Asafoetida
Method :

Remove the stems, wash the coriander leaves and let it dry for 1 hour.
In a kadai, heat oil, add kadalai paruppu, ullutham paruppu, red chillies, perungayam, tamarind. Fry golden. Add the salt / sugar.
First grind these items coarsely in a mixi. To this add the fresh coriander leaves and grind it nicely. There is no need to add water. The end product will be like thick chutney. Bottle and store it in a refrigerator if you're using the next day.
